Output e48bbf00a6389008a50c7719d91e95fb17dd7ca81fd25290cf16bc07a2ccadd6:30

value
1351220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8adfba3f0e55f5b7dd26c92ae472da1830aa636 OP_EQUAL
address
3QMuvfc2LK7nnHFfrbYSNjq4o1ui2zX2oz
transaction
e48bbf00a6389008a50c7719d91e95fb17dd7ca81fd25290cf16bc07a2ccadd6
confirmations
326644
spent
true